Peer to Peer Networking

0
Certificate

Paid

Language

Level

Advanced

Access

Free

Last updated on April 21, 2026 3:24 pm

This comprehensive free online course breaks down all aspects of P2P networking and shows you how to set up your own network using Pastry, Kademlia or Tapestry.

Add your review

This course explains how different elements communicate with each other within a network. You will learn the essentials of peer-to-peer communication, creating secure data communication using advanced encryption and how nodes authenticate themselves through private and public keys. Illustrations will help demonstrate how nodes route their traffic to the correct users.

What You Will Learn In This Free Course

  • Identify the different elements of a…
  • Explain how network certificates are…
  • Discuss the function of leaf, root a…
  • Describe the purpose and functionali…
  • Identify the different elements of an IP network
  • Explain how network certificates are used and verified
  • Discuss the function of leaf, root and core nodes
  • Describe the purpose and functionality of a distributed hash table (DHT)
  • State the type of messages sent in DHT networks
  • Explain the process of static and dynamic partitioning of a node ID space
  • Compute node IDs in the octal and hexadecimal number systems
  • Explain the process of how a new node enters a network
  • Explain how routing tables are updated in Kademlia and Pastry
  • Describe how routing tables are managed in a multi-layer DHT network
  • An Introduction to Peer to Peer Networking

    In this module, you will learn about the fundamentals of Peer-to-Peer networking, VoIP telephony and how secure IP channels are set up. You will also be introduced to Distributed Hash Tables (DHT) and how routing tables are populated.

    Logarithmic Partitioning and Messaging in DHT networks

    In this module, you will learn about Logarithmic Partitioning and Index Entry Authenticity. You will also learn about the different messages sent in DHT networks and how the partitioning of node IDs occur.; Module

    First Assessment

    This assessment will determine your knowledge and understanding of the course section entitled – Introduction to Peer to Peer Networks, Logarithmic Partitioning and Messaging in DHT networks; Module

    PASTRY and Kadmelia Protocols

    In this module, you will be introduced to the PASTRY and Kadmelia Protocols. Extensive examples will be given on how these protocols work in a computer network and how the routing tables are populated.; Module

    Tapestry and Multi-Layer DHT

    In this module, you will learn about the evolution of Kademlia and how it is applied to current networking processes. You will also be introduced to the Tapestry protocol, the Multi-dimensional Distributed Hash Table and how routing management occurs for a Multiple Service platform.

    Second Assessment

    This assessment will determine your knowledge and understanding of the course section entitled – Understanding the PASTRY and Tapestry in Networking.; Module

    Course assessment

    User Reviews

    0.0 out of 5
    0
    0
    0
    0
    0
    Write a review

    There are no reviews yet.

    Be the first to review “Peer to Peer Networking”

    ×

      Your Email (required)

      Report this page
      Peer to Peer Networking
      Peer to Peer Networking
      LiveTalent.org
      Logo
      LiveTalent.org
      Privacy Overview

      This website uses cookies so that we can provide you with the best user experience possible. Cookie information is stored in your browser and performs functions such as recognising you when you return to our website and helping our team to understand which sections of the website you find most interesting and useful.